>>> nitpick: I think you need {} for the else part too now a days..
>>
>> you mean as a CodingStyle issue, or a compiler issue?
>> do you have a reference for this requirement?
>>
>> do you mean if the 'if' part has {}, the else part should too, even if
>> it's a single line?
>>
>> I don't really care one way or the other, just want to know more about
>> what you're suggesting.
> Apologies on the obscure comment. I meant Coding style.
> Documentation/CodingStyle says:
>
> 171 This does not apply if one branch of a conditional statement is a
> single
> 172 statement. Use braces in both branches.
> 173
> 174 if (condition) {
> 175 do_this();
> 176 do_that();
> 177 } else {
> 178 otherwise();
> 179 }
doh, looks like I should've RTFM.
Thanks for the pointer.
